At the recent buildingSMART International Summit in Berlin, LeapThought demonstrated its global leadership in shaping how open standards evolve into systems of governance for the built environment.

Marking our fifth consecutive Platinum Sponsorship, we showcased Holistic Built Environment Intelligence (HBEI) — a paradigm shift in how infrastructure is delivered and managed. HBEI unifies human and machine intelligence across the asset lifecycle, transforming fragmented data into foresight, resilience, and accountable governance at portfolio scale.


FULCRUMHQ, supercharged by GenieHQ AI, together enable our One Model approach: an environment where BIM, GIS, survey, telemetry, and operational data are unified into an Intelligent Connected Data Environment (ICDE). By utilizing information in all its forms—structured, unstructured, and graphical—GenieHQ ensures project data is always enriched and actionable.

Already trusted on more than $300B in infrastructure worldwide, FULCRUMHQ demonstrates that open standards deliver their greatest value when embedded into living systems of record — not as theory, but as operational reality at national scale.
